Add to favorites
Remove from favorites
< Back to 59—Needham Junction - Watertown Square

As of 03:27 PM (update)

Route 59—Needham Junction - Watertown Square

5 min—Needham Junction via Needham St (#y3297) 1.1 miles away
52 min—Needham Junction via Needham St (#y3241) 6.9 miles away

Map view of Webster St @ Central Ave